Is there any way that I could store letters of recommendation on a website? I remember reading about sites like interfolio, but am not sure how/if they work.

I am a senior in undergrad who applied this cycle and am waitlisted, and am thinking it would be a good idea to store letters from my recommenders this cycle (professors) somewhere in case I have to apply again to avoid having to reach out professors I had several years ago in case they had forgotten me in the sea of students they teach every year 🙁

Help!!
 
Interfolio worked well for me. My professors had no problem sending my LORs to Interfolio and I had no problem forwarding them to AADSAS. But since you already applied, you will need to have your professors resend your LORs to Interfolio with confidentiality.

So I used interfolio for that reason but the recommenders send their letters to interfolio and interfolio sends them to your application. You still are unable to read the letter. If your recommenders sent the letters directly into the application you’ll be unable to get them.

With that being said, you could ask your recommenders to send it again (assuming they saved the letter) to your interfolio account.
